Awareness Caravan to Al-Shubak Village, Al-Badrasheen, Giza Governorate
As part of the Faculty of Engineering's community service and environmental development initiatives, and under the supervision of Professor Prof. Hinar Abu Al-Magd, Vice Dean for Community Service and Environmental Development, students from the Faculty participated in an awareness caravan to Al-Shubak Village, Al-Badrasheen, Giza Governorate. The caravan was organized by the Faculty of Nursing at 6th of October University. The caravan aimed to raise community awareness and promote positive behaviors, addressing several important topics including:
Water conservation and preserving water resources
Electricity conservation and promoting a culture of responsible energy use
Raising awareness about the dangers of harassment and methods of prevention and safe interaction
Raising awareness about the dangers of addiction, its health and social effects, and methods of prevention. The students of the Faculty of Engineering actively contributed to the awareness campaign, reflecting their awareness of their community role and their keenness to participate positively in initiatives that serve the community.
This participation comes within the framework of strengthening cooperation between the university's various faculties and activating the role of educational institutions in supporting community issues and spreading health and behavioral awareness.
